From simplex slicing to sharp reverse Hölder inequalities (2505.00944v1)

Published 2 May 2025 in math.MG, math.FA, and math.PR

Abstract: Simplex slicing (Webb, 1996) is a sharp upper bound on the volume of central hyperplane sections of the regular simplex. We extend this to sharp bounds in the probabilistic framework of negative moments, and beyond, of centred log-concave random variables, establishing a curious phase transition of the extremising distribution for new sharp reverse H\"older-type inequalities.
